Quick Take for Sunday, September 30, 2012 (Fast Affiliate Live + Same Day Ratings)

Delivering Impressive Results with its Sunday Drama Openings, ABC is the Only Net to Grow Year to Year Among Adults 18-49

ABC Finishes Season Premiere Week with the No. 1 Scripted Show, The No. 1 Drama and the No. 1 New Comedy Among Adults 18-49

Sunday's No. 1 Scripted Show in Adults 18-49, ABC's "Once Upon a Time" Opens its Sophomore Season with its Strongest Rating Since Last October

Opening Strong on its New Night and Time, ABC's "Revenge" Premieres With the Series' 2nd-Highest-Ever Numbers in Viewers and Young Adults

"666 Park Avenue" Debuts as the No. 1 Non-Sports Program in the 10pm Hour, Beating CBS' "The Mentalist" and Improving its Time Period Over Last Season

Sunday Night (7:00-11:00 p.m.)

With a series recap of "Once Upon a Time" leading into its sophomore season premiere, followed by the sophomore opener of "Revenge" and the debut of "666 Park Avenue," up against NBC's Sunday Night Football and an NFL-overrun boosted Fox, ABC beat out CBS' season premiere Sunday by 29% in Adults 18-49 (2.7/7 vs. 2.1/5). ABC's sophomore season opener of "Once Upon a Time" stood as the night's No. 1 non-sports program in Adults 18-49.

· Despite airing a clip show in the 7:00 p.m. hour, ABC was the only net to grow over season-premiere Sunday last year in Adults 18-49 (+8%).

2012-13 Season Premiere Week Adult 18-49 Rankings: ABC will finish season premiere week with the No. 1 scripted series/comedy in "Modern Family," the No. 1 drama in "Grey's Anatomy" and the No. 1 new comedy in "The Neighbors."

"Once Upon a Time" (8:00-9:00 p.m.)

More than doubling its lead-in (+111%), ABC's season opener of "Once Upon a Time" dominated its non-sports competition in the 8 o'clock hour in Adults 18-49 to emerge as Sunday's top-rated scripted show. In its time period, ABC's "Once Upon a Time" (3.8/10) defeated Fox's NFL-driven animated comedy premieres ("The Simpsons"/"Bob's Burgers" = 3.1/8) by 23% and CBS' season premiere of "The Amazing Race" by 52% (2.5/6). The Disney-owned drama ranked as the No. 1 TV program of the night overall across all key Women demographics (W18-34/W18-49/W25-54).

· "Once Upon a Time" paced well ahead of its freshman season finale in May, pulling in its biggest audience since November and equaling its best Adult 18-49 number since last October � since 11/13/11 and 10/30/11. In addition the show hit series highs with Adults 18-34 and Women 18-34, while marking its 2nd-highest-ever rating with Teens 12-17.

"Revenge" (9:00-10:00 p.m.)

Leading its entertainment competition in its new Sunday 9 o'clock time slot among Adults 18-49, ABC's sophomore season premiere of "Revenge" (3.2/7) topped Fox's animated comedy openers ("Family Guy"/"American Dad" = 2.9/7) by 10% and impressively beat out the season opener of CBS' time-period established "The Good Wife" by 78% (1.8/4).

· Up sharply from its first season closer on Wednesday in May, "Revenge" scored the series' 2nd-highest ratings ever in Total Viewers (9.5 million) and Adults 18-49, while earning new series highs with Adults 18-34 and Women 18-34.

"666 Park Avenue" (10:00-11:00 p.m.)

Ranking as the No. 1 non-sports program in the 10:00 p.m. hour, ABC's series debut of "666 Park Avenue" defeated CBS' premiere of veteran "The Mentalist" by 25% in Adults 18-34 (1.5/4 vs. 1.2/3) and by 5% in Adults 18-49 (2.2/5 vs. 2.1/5).

· "666 Park Avenue" topped ABC's 2011-12 season averages in the time period by 25% in Total Viewers and by 22% in Adults 18-49. In fact among Adults 18-49 the new show posted the Net's best performance with a Sunday 10 o'clock series since March � since 3/11/12.

A note about increasing DVR penetration and year-to-year rating comparisons: Year-to-year rating comparisons based on the Live + Same Day data stream are distorted by the level of DVR penetration in the Nielsen sample, which has jumped up to 46% currently, from 42% at the same point in 2011. More viewers are watching shows on their own timetables, which may not be reflected in the overnight next day numbers. The only truly valid year-to-year comparison would be one based on the Live + 7 Day metric, once those stats are released by Nielsen.
